Our review of the WateLves Barefoot Water Shoes finds them best for casual walkers, beachgoers, and anyone who wants a lightweight, easy on/off shoe that feels close to the ground. The single biggest reason to buy is the barefoot, zero-drop design paired with a knit sock-like upper that delivers a comfortable, breathable fit for warm-weather use and quick trips to the pool or shore. They are not a heavy-duty hiking shoe, but for everyday water and walking activities they hit the balance of comfort, grip, and low weight.
Key Features
- Zero-drop barefoot design: Provides a close-to-the-ground feel that helps with natural foot movement while walking and light activity.
- Knit fabric upper: Breathable, lightweight knit keeps feet cool and helps prevent excess sweat during warm weather use.
- Slip-on construction: Easy to put on and take off, making them convenient for beach days, poolside use, or quick errands.
- High quality soles: Durable, slip-resistant soles give good traction on wet surfaces and wood floors, reducing slips.
- Fashionable sock-like look: The minimalist, sock-like appearance pairs easily with casual outfits for a modern, low-profile style.
Who It's For
These shoes suit people who value a lightweight, minimal shoe for beachwear, poolside use, and everyday walking where protection from rough terrain is not required. Customers who like a wide toe box and a true-to-size fit will appreciate the comfortable room and the breathable knit fabric.
They are not intended for technical trails, heavy hiking, or activities that require significant ankle support or thick cushioning. If you need a robust hiking or running shoe with substantial padding, look elsewhere for more support and protection.
